Job Summary

The Corporate Lending Officer reviews credit data and evaluates commercial loan requests with a high level of expertise to aid in the credit approval process with the goal of maximizing bank profits and minimize the risk of loss.

 

Essential Functions, Duties and Responsibilities include, but are not limited to:

  • Analyzes credit data, financial statements and other financial information to determine the degree of risk involved in extending credit or lending money on commercial loans and to access proper pricing and structure for said loans
  • Maintains a strong working knowledge of the bank's loan policies/philosophy, pertinent operating procedures and loan regulations
  • Provides assistance and support to Senior Lenders to determine strengths and weaknesses of a commercial credit
